God's day to you, Mouse, I think it is as important to mediatate (study) the Bible as what you read. Scripture is not just a textbook that we should read thru in a year. As I study, I learn more, even if it is the fiftieth time I looked at a passage. Also, when I listen or read others, it helps me link the Bible. Psalm 19:14 is a good verse, "Let the words of my mouth and the meditation of my heart be acceptable in Your sight, O LORD, my rock and my Redeemer". What do I think and say? Look at Psalm 119 on how it tlaks about mediate: ... Ps 119:15 I will meditate on Your precepts and regard Your ways. ... Ps 119:23 Even though princes sit and talk against me, Your servant meditates on Your statutes. ... Ps 119:27 Make me understand the way of Your precepts, so I will meditate on Your wonders. ... Ps 119:48 And I shall lift up my hands to Your commandments, which I love; and I will meditate on Your statutes. Zayin. ... Ps 119:78 May the arrogant be ashamed, for they subvert me with a lie; but I shall meditate on Your precepts. ... Ps 119:148 My eyes anticipate the night watches, that I may meditate on Your word. The Holy Spirit will guide you - but you need to study. Study deeper than you do (did) for school. Searcher |
